Creating the Archer Instance

You create instances in the Archer Control Panel and then designate 1 of them as the default instance for all users.

Task 1: Start the Archer Queuing service

  1. Go to Start > Services to open the Services window.
  2. In the Archer Queuing list, verify that the Archer Queuing service is running.
    • If the service is running, skip to Task 2.
    • If the service is not running, continue to Step 4.
  3. Right-click Archer Queuing.
  4. Click Start.
